December 17 is celebrated as the "Day of the red umbrella" — world day of protection of sex workers from violence and abuse.

This memorable day came in 2003, originally in order to commemorate the victims of a serial killer from America that tracked and killed sex workers and adolescent girls runaway from home.

Later this day became an event of international importance, to which every year growing numbers of activists and organizations, as sex workers around the world face similar forms of institutionalized violence and discrimination. Crimes motivated by intolerance and violence against sex workers stem from prejudices, social stigma and laws criminalizing prostitution. This situation of intolerance contributes to the Commission of crimes against people who in all other situations, comply with the law.
